Moving files within same share is slow?

Featured Replies

Hi all,

 

- 4 x 8 TB array (58% used)

- no parity disk

- share 'media' (xfs) is set as: use all disk, no exclude, split only top level if needed.

 

Doing: Moving files from share (subfolders) movies -> movies-uhd

 

Looking at the docker (radarr) i used or doing it in Unraid gui (dynamix plugin) yields the same results. Same with unbalance ..

When i try to move files... 150-180 MB/sec instead of what i expected .. MORE OR LESS instant.

 

Deletes of say 70 GB files are like instant.

 

Am i missing something?

Dynamix File Manager does Move as Copy to destination then Delete from source. Maybe 'arrs do too.
